Be warned, I find this one fun – no, there was no mummy. Snopes.com does an excellent job on the summery at http://www.snopes.com/horrors/ghosts/mummy.asp That hasn’t stopped a lot of us Titaniacs from expanding the story – at one point we had people believing that there WAS a mummy, having some passenger take it into the lifeboat and on to the _Carpathia_ (yea, like that wouldn’t be noticed and photographed!) We then had the mummy returning to England on the _Empress of Ireland_ (I’m assuming you know that shipwreck? http://www.pbs.org/lostliners/empress.html), being brought back from Europe on the _Hindenberg_ and being rescued by a passenger who lived in Florida, put into storage for a great many years, and then loaded on the Space Shuttle _Columbia_ that fatal day.
